This study aims to examine the effect of digital media use on improving student learning outcomes at STIT Miftahul Midad Lumajang. A quantitative research approach with a quasi-experimental design was employed. The population consisted of 30 students from a single class, who were given both pre-tests and post-tests to assess their learning performance before and after the integration of digital media in the learning process. The findings revealed a significant improvement in students’ learning outcomes following the implementation of digital media. These results suggest that digital media can serve as an effective tool to enhance learning quality in higher education, particularly in promoting better understanding of the material and increasing student engagement in the classroom.
